Problems with Samba after changing Root Password - Please Help

I have an installation of VAS that is running on RedHat EL 4.0. The vas portion is working ok, and with out any problems so far.

I also have the Vintela version of Samba running on the system (Version 3.0.23c-Quest-154). The root password on the server was changed in February, and since the change I have been receiving the following error from Winbind.

[2007/03/21 09:31:30, 0] /data/rc/u/davidl/samba/samba/source/libads/kerberos.c:ads_kinit_password(208)
kerberos_kinit_password STORM$@CAMPUS.MCGILL.CA failed: Preauthentication failed
[2007/03/21 09:31:30, 0] /data/rc/u/davidl/samba/samba/source/libads/kerberos.c:ads_kinit_password(208)
kerberos_kinit_password STORM$@CAMPUS.MCGILL.CA failed: Preauthentication failed
[2007/03/21 09:31:30, 0] /data/rc/u/davidl/samba/samba/source/utils/net_ads.c:ads_startup(281)
ads_connect: Preauthentication failed

I have run the following commands trying to trouble shoot this trying to figure out why this stopped working after I changed the password:

/opt/quest/bin/net ads testjoin --> Produces the above results

/opt/quest/bin/net rpc testjoin --> Unable to find a suitable server
Join to domain 'CAMPUS' is not valid

I ran this command to make sure that the passwords were in sync vastool -u host/ passwd -r | net -f -i changesecretpw

I am not seeing any errors in my smb.conf file, so I am at a lost what to do.
